FNGN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2015 in Review

173 of the 3,812 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Financial Engines, Inc. (FNGN) for Q4 2015, worth a combined $2.01B — up 9.4% from $1.84B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 31 funds opened new FNGN positions and 22 closed out — a net gain of 9 holders — while 59 added to existing stakes and 63 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Lord, Abbett & Co, opening a new position worth an estimated $20.7M. The largest seller was Wellington Management Group, exiting entirely with an estimated $62.7M sold.
